Our database of currently 414 national and naval flags from around the world includes mainly countries (e.g. 193 UN members + 2 observers), and partially recognized nations, as well as other independently governed bodies (i.e. subnational and unincorporated). 279 of these are "national" flags, ones representing the nation or body as a whole, and 135 being naval ensigns and jacks of many of these bodies.
The "national" flags used mostly follow a popularity trend. Typically civil ensigns are used if not official national flags. If the state flag is more of a standard, then that can be seen, too. "Unofficial" flags are often used for unincorporated bodies for them to be unique, and because they are often adopted by the local governing body.
